Regarding the high exposure of cockroaches to insecticides in hospitals, the chance for development of resistance is increasing. To determine susceptibility of different strains of Belattella germanica L. to Lambadacygalothrin and Cypermethrin insecticides. The strains were collected from 5 hospital affiliated to Tehran university of medical sciences [Emam, Dr. Shariatii, Markaz e tebi, Ziaeian, Baharlou]. Susceptibility tests were carried out on 1-3 days nymphs according to WHO standard method in different time. Finding: Susceptibility tests on 1-3 days nymphs indicated that the strains of German cockroaches collected from hospital mentioned above were all resistant to Cypermethrin and also with some susceptibility changes to Lambadcyhalothrin. The resistance observed in our study may be due to current use of insecticide for German cockroach control and hence the development of cross resistance to these insecticides

The genetics and mechanism of malathion resistance in the adults of An. stephensi [BAN-S], Was studied. Nine successive generations of malathion selection in the adults resulted in an increase in LTSO of about 3-fold. The crossing experiments indicated that the resistance is inherited as partially dominant character with no indication of sex linkage. The results of back-crosses suggested that probably more than one genetic factor are responsible for malathion resistance. Synergist study with TPP and PB indicated that the involvement of carboxyesterase as the main resistance factor in An. Srephensi. The cross- resistance spectrum of malathion resistance with pirimiphos- methyl, DDT and dieldrin were studied in the selected strain. The results did not show any relationship between resistances to malathion, DDTand pirimiphos- methyl. Dieldurin test on the selected and uselected strains showed that malathin resistance could increase dieldrin resitance
